Had a fantastic week staying at the barn at the Star Inn in Porkellis. Andrew and Anthony are really lovely hosts and the Star Inn is fabulous. We were made to feel very welcome by all the staff and locals, and the menu was so great we had our evening meal there every night that it was open (Weds to Sun). The barn was comfortable, clean and has everything you could need for self catering, but with the Star Inn only 5 yards away there is really no need to cook. Porkellis is a tiny village away from the busy tourist hot spots, and is a perfectly located central base for exploring South West Cornwall. We highly recommend the barn at the Star Inn and can’t wait to go back to experience the wonderful hospitality once more. Our main tips for future travellers would be: 1. The roads leading to the village are narrow, so definitely follow the instructions that are sent to you for the best route into the village; 2. Book ahead for the evening meals because the Star Inn is unsurprisingly very popular; 3. Cornwall can be very humid so definitely a good idea to use the dehumidifier that is thoughtfully provided by the hosts, we found it especially useful in the bedroom; 4. Be kind to the staff at the Inn, they work really hard and go out of their way to make you feel welcome and ensure that you have everything you need. 5.
